from smolagents import CodeAgent,DuckDuckGoSearchTool, HfApiModel,load_tool,tool
import datetime
import requests
import pytz
import yaml
from tools.final_answer import FinalAnswerTool
from Gradio_UI import GradioUI
@tool
def summarize_webpage(url: str, max_length: int = 300) -> str:
"""A tool that fetches a webpage and provides a concise summary of its content.
Args:
url: The URL of the webpage to summarize
max_length: Maximum length of the summary in characters
"""
try:
import requests
from bs4 import BeautifulSoup
import re
# Fetch the webpage
headers = {'User-Agent': '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 10.0; Win64; x64) AppleWebKit/537.36 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/91.0.4472.124 Safari/537.36'}
response = requests.get(url, headers=headers, timeout=10)
response.raise_for_status()
# Parse HTML content
soup = BeautifulSoup(response.content, 'html.parser')
# Remove script and style elements
for script in soup(["script", "style", "header", "footer", "nav"]):
script.extract()
# Get text and clean it
text = soup.get_text()
lines = (line.strip() for line in text.splitlines())
chunks = (phrase.strip() for line in lines for phrase in line.split(" "))
text = '\n'.join(chunk for chunk in chunks if chunk)
# Remove excessive newlines and whitespace
text = re.sub(r'\n+', '\n', text)
text = re.sub(r'\s+', ' ', text)
# Truncate to avoid overwhelming the model
text = text[:10000] if len(text) > 10000 else text
# Get title
title = soup.title.string if soup.title else "Unknown Title"
# For the summarization, we'll use our agent's model directly
# Note: This assumes the agent will handle the summarization part
return {
"title": title,
"url": url,
"content": text,
"summary_request": f"Please summarize the above webpage content in no more than {max_length} characters."
}
except Exception as e:
return f"Error fetching or processing webpage: {str(e)}"
@tool
def get_current_time_in_timezone(timezone: str) -> str:
"""A tool that fetches the current local time in a specified timezone.
Args:
timezone: A string representing a valid timezone (e.g., 'America/New_York').
"""
try:
# Create timezone object
tz = pytz.timezone(timezone)
# Get current time in that timezone
local_time = datetime.datetime.now(tz).strftime("%Y-%m-%d %H:%M:%S")
return f"The current local time in {timezone} is: {local_time}"
except Exception as e:
return f"Error fetching time for timezone '{timezone}': {str(e)}"
final_answer = FinalAnswerTool()
# If the agent does not answer, the model is overloaded, please use another model or the following Hugging Face Endpoint that also contains qwen2.5 coder:
# model_id='https://pflgm2locj2t89co.us-east-1.aws.endpoints.huggingface.cloud'
model = HfApiModel(
max_tokens=2096,
temperature=0.5,
model_id='Qwen/Qwen2.5-Coder-32B-Instruct',# it is possible that this model may be overloaded
custom_role_conversions=None,
)
# Import tool from Hub
image_generation_tool = load_tool("agents-course/text-to-image", trust_remote_code=True)
with open("prompts.yaml", 'r') as stream:
prompt_templates = yaml.safe_load(stream)
agent = CodeAgent(
model=model,
tools=[final_answer, summarize_webpage], ## add your tools here (don't remove final answer)
max_steps=6,
verbosity_level=1,
grammar=None,
planning_interval=None,
name=None,
description=None,
prompt_templates=prompt_templates
)
GradioUI(agent).launch() |
